diff options
author | GitLab Bot <gitlab-bot@gitlab.com> | 2023-12-11 15:13:09 +0300 |
---|---|---|
committer | GitLab Bot <gitlab-bot@gitlab.com> | 2023-12-11 15:13:09 +0300 |
commit | ee2024d964d1742a8ec01da89e0b34351c9303ab (patch) | |
tree | 7c8108788f3db88c579974951bb2cb1b792e871e /app/assets/stylesheets/framework | |
parent | 5f6fe673fa797f46ee747df4553a9c216224bb85 (diff) |
Add latest changes from gitlab-org/gitlab@master
Diffstat (limited to 'app/assets/stylesheets/framework')
-rw-r--r-- | app/assets/stylesheets/framework/header.scss | 69 | ||||
-rw-r--r-- | app/assets/stylesheets/framework/layout.scss | 2 |
2 files changed, 65 insertions, 6 deletions
diff --git a/app/assets/stylesheets/framework/header.scss b/app/assets/stylesheets/framework/header.scss index 2265d425e1f..7c6a3963d75 100644 --- a/app/assets/stylesheets/framework/header.scss +++ b/app/assets/stylesheets/framework/header.scss @@ -335,11 +335,70 @@ } } -header.navbar-gitlab.super-sidebar-logged-out { - background-color: $brand-charcoal !important; - li.nav-item > button, - li.nav-item > a { +.header-logged-out { + z-index: $header-zindex; + min-height: var(--header-height); + position: fixed; + top: $calc-system-headers-height; + left: 0; + right: 0; + background-color: $brand-charcoal; +} + +.header-logged-out-nav { + position: relative; + min-height: var(--header-height); +} + +.header-logged-out-logo { + a { + display: flex; + align-items: center; + padding: 4px; + margin-left: -4px; + border-radius: $border-radius-default; + + &:hover, + &:focus { + background-color: $brand-gray-04; + } + + &:focus, + &:active { + @include gl-focus; + } + + &:active { + background-color: $brand-gray-03; + } + } +} + +.header-logged-out-toggle { + appearance: none; + border: 0; + background-color: transparent; + border-radius: $border-radius-default; +} + +.header-logged-out-dropdown { + position: static; + + .dropdown-menu { + position: absolute; + width: 100%; + min-width: 100%; + } +} + +.header-logged-out-nav-item { + > button, + > a { + display: inline-block; + padding: 6px 8px; + height: 32px; + border-radius: $border-radius-default; @include gl-text-gray-100; @include gl-font-weight-normal; @include gl-font-base; @@ -347,7 +406,7 @@ header.navbar-gitlab.super-sidebar-logged-out { &:hover, &:focus, &:active { - @include gl-text-white + @include gl-text-white; } &:hover, diff --git a/app/assets/stylesheets/framework/layout.scss b/app/assets/stylesheets/framework/layout.scss index 6606f5b35a3..7ec13c3d54c 100644 --- a/app/assets/stylesheets/framework/layout.scss +++ b/app/assets/stylesheets/framework/layout.scss @@ -154,7 +154,7 @@ body { overflow: hidden; > #js-peek, - > .navbar-gitlab { + > .header-logged-out { position: static; top: auto; } |